The renovation of this intricate and characterful period property based Roundhay, Leeds was a welcome challenge following our appointment.
From the moment you arrived through the front entrance all the way through to disjointed connection with the back garden, this existing home, whilst filled with character and beautiful historic features, severely lacked any natural flow and functionality.
The unconventional sloping site and "semi-basement" nature of the lower ground floor presented a difficult, but welcome challenge to transform our clients home into the much-wanted, light and open space she desired, whilst remaining sympathetic to the homes style and character.
Our final scheme presented the approach of upside-down living with bedrooms and bathrooms predominantly located on the lower ground floor and general living spaces on the upper ground floor. From the split-level entrance hall to the extensive structural remodelling, basement underpinning and glazing alterations, the final design offered a stark contrast to the previous, dark and congested layout, providing a light and open living space subtly tailored to meet the individual needs of our client and her daughter.
